Vortex Optics headquarters are located in Wisconsin. Vortex Optics headquarters are located in a tiny village in Wisconsin. They manufacture one model in their home in the United States. The American Made Glass Vortex Razor HD AMG 6-24×50 rifle scope is manufactured in Wisconsin using laser precision. The remainder of the Razor line is made in Japan. However, its quality and performance of Vortex’s Razor HD scope is unmatched. A top-quality Vortex rifle scope will make all the difference in the hunting adventure.

The red dots are very cost-effective. The Vortex Sparc, which is priced at less than $200, is lightweight and compact, and very flexible. Its bright and daylight-colored 2 MOA dot and ten adjustable lighting settings make it ideal for any circumstance, and it only requires only one AAA battery. It also features a robust and robust chassis. Additionally, it’s fog-proof as well as waterproof, making it one of the most adaptable and affordable red dots on the market.
